Where to go

No trip to Paris can be complete without a visit to the Eiffel tower. This structure is the most popular one in France. Built in 1889 the Eiffel Tower is an extravagant addition to a city that boasts of history that dates back many centuries. The Eiffel Tower was almost brought down when it was first disclosed, but today, is a symbol of modern Paris. There are two restaurants located in the Eiffel tower that make for a perfect romantic dinner.

If you are looking to mix history with gourmet, Le Bon Marche is the place to be. Being the first department store in Paris that was established in 1852, this is a one stop shop. What’s more? The food hall here is just amazing with a wide array of choices. Night life in Paris is impressive with one of it’s first cabarets, Moulin Rouge. Established in 1889 it is famous for its dancers.

 

Catch a taxi

Paris has over 20,000 taxis operating all over the city. Visitors can find a taxi on taxi rank, on the streets or call a radio- cab. There is a standardised rate that applies to all taxis in Paris. You can spot a vacant taxi by the light on top of it.
